Nurofen 400 mg Soft Capsules, 20 Capsules
Nurofen soft capsules contain 400 mg of ibuprofen in a fast-absorbing liquid core, making them quicker to relieve pain than standard tablets. Suitable for adults and adolescents (≥ 12 years or ≥ 40 kg), they effectively relieve mild to moderate pain (e.g., headache, toothache, period cramps), fever, and cold-related symptoms. :contentReference[oaicite:0]{index=0}

Dosage & Administration
- Adults & adolescents (≥ 12 years, ≥ 40 kg): Take 1 capsule with water, up to every 6 hours as needed. Do not exceed 3 capsules (1200 mg) in 24 hours. :contentReference[oaicite:6]{index=6}
- Recommended for sensitive stomachs: take with or after meals. :contentReference[oaicite:7]{index=7}
- Discontinue use and consult a doctor if symptoms persist—adults shouldn't use more than 3 days for fever or 4 days for pain without medical advice. :contentReference[oaicite:8]{index=8}
Active & Inactive Ingredients
- Active Ingredient: 400 mg ibuprofen per capsule. :contentReference[oaicite:9]{index=9}
- Excipients: Macrogol 600, potassium hydroxide, purified water; capsule shell contains gelatin, sorbitol (E420), Ponceau 4R (E124); printing ink includes titanium dioxide (E171), propylene glycol, hypromellose. :contentReference[oaicite:10]{index=10}
Warnings & Contraindications
- Do not use if allergic to ibuprofen, sorbitol, Ponceau 4R, or any ingredients. :contentReference[oaicite:11]{index=11}
- Avoid use in individuals with a history of gastrointestinal ulcers, bleeding, severe liver, kidney or heart disease, dehydration, or bleeding disorders. Not for use in the last trimester of pregnancy. :contentReference[oaicite:12]{index=12}
- Use with caution in conditions such as asthma, inflammatory bowel disease, blood clotting disorders, hypertension, heart diseases, diabetes, or connective tissue diseases. Elderly patients require careful monitoring. :contentReference[oaicite:13]{index=13}
- May mask symptoms of infections; consult a doctor if symptoms worsen or persist. :contentReference[oaicite:14]{index=14}
Side Effects & Overdose
- Common side effects: nausea, vomiting, abdominal pain, dizziness, skin rash, headaches, sleep disturbances. :contentReference[oaicite:15]{index=15}
- Overdose may cause nausea, vomiting, low blood pressure, dizziness, respiratory issues—seek immediate medical help. :contentReference[oaicite:16]{index=16}
Safety & Alertness
May impair alertness when used in higher doses or combined with alcohol. Avoid driving or operating heavy machinery if you experience dizziness or visual disturbances. :contentReference[oaicite:17]{index=17}
